Transaction 956493af40ff8cd149edf7955ae08f75d710f2e2e5709071a4a973f49d42b91f
1 Input
2 Outputs
- 956493af40ff8cd149edf7955ae08f75d710f2e2e5709071a4a973f49d42b91f:0
- 956493af40ff8cd149edf7955ae08f75d710f2e2e5709071a4a973f49d42b91f:1
value 4084403
address 1EFVHcePKcXWwuMrkHXyfNLoBkhqhdX69q
value 714692
address 1HxbfA3bXJQf3zNUQGboDtuPpg4TMBxoPA